What Causes High Blood Sugar?

The body has a regulation system for keeping your blood sugar in a tight range. So if it's dropping too low, either after exercise or after a meal, usually what's happening there is you're having an over release of insulin. The other side of that coin is adrenal function because your adrenals make hormones like cortisol and adrenaline which have the opposite effect,. they actually tell your liver to make and or release more glucose.
